Transaction 17668dd5769918f96e0982e45edf440dcbc6745183e800e35a223e4666823abd

2 Input
2 Outputs
  • 17668dd5769918f96e0982e45edf440dcbc6745183e800e35a223e4666823abd:0
  • value  1653177932
    address  1FnynTXoCDSLifK9Ebqw5nuMuTo5VGzdJJ
  • 17668dd5769918f96e0982e45edf440dcbc6745183e800e35a223e4666823abd:1
  • value  31936187
    address  3FpsXy2FQNfeU5qnj4u2LfRn4owCwY4Mvv